What To Do After Losing A Tooth
As children, we lose our primary teeth as a natural part of growing up. However, as adults, losing teeth is caused by oral health issues. Periodontal disease is the number one cause. Since missing teeth at this age isn’t natural, this means problems. You could have problems consuming solid foods. Problems talking clearly may develop. For minor cases, a dental bridge could be placed, providing lifelike results. For several missing teeth, partials could offer a solution and rebuild your smile. Finally, a complete denture could be crafted and secured. While most fulls and partials are removable, they could be secured with long-lasting dental implants. Dental implants essentially look and function like natural teeth, and stimulate bone preservation in your jawbones and facial structure following tooth loss.
